Responsibilities
- Design and implement quantum algorithms for optimization and simulation problems
- Collaborate with hardware engineers to improve quantum processor stability and qubit coherence
- Lead research initiatives in error correction and quantum machine learning
- Publish findings in peer-reviewed journals and present at international conferences
- Secure research funding through government and private sector grants
- Mentor junior researchers and foster cross-functional innovation
- Contribute to open-source quantum computing frameworks
Qualifications
- PhD in Physics, Computer Science, or related field with quantum computing focus
- 3+ years of experience with quantum programming languages (Q#, Qiskit, Cirq)
- Expertise in quantum error correction and fault-tolerant architectures
- Strong publication record in top-tier quantum computing journals
- Proficiency in high-performance computing environments
- Experience with quantum hardware platforms (IBM Quantum, Rigetti, etc.)
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ities
